The Kapiti Coast is one of the   fastest growing regions in New Zealand and Raumati Beach is one of the highest   income areas on the Kapiti Coast with the highest concentration of   people with incomes over $100,000pa. The vehicular traffic count, currently 8,400/day, is  expected to grow to around 10 - 11,000/day by 2016. Kapiti's current population of around 47,000 is projected to increase to 55,000 by   2016 and 60,000 by 2031. Perhaps the most important  (yet unknown) fact is that Kapiti has 2.28 million visitors per annum and  this is projected to grow to 2.4 million by 2013. 
Kapiti is a destination for many people in the region and Raumati Beach is positioning itself to become the destination of choice within Kapiti. In 2006 international and domestic travelers spent $184 million in this region and this is projected to grow to $225 million by 2013.
